Feedback is something we reciprocate every day.  Some forms of feedback are obvious such as an online product review while others like graded homework assignments or a tips left for a server, are not.  While identifying feedback isn’t always easy, nor is distinguishing between positive and negative; the bigger challenge is developing a strategy that uses feedback to your advantage.
